When is the best time to book a Bed and Breakfast in Audlem?
The best time to book a B&B in Audlem is during the spring months, particularly in May, when the charming village comes to life with vibrant blooms and pleasant weather. This period marks the peak season, running from April to June, and is superb for those who appreciate leisurely strolls along the picturesque canals, engaging in outdoor activities, and soaking in the local atmosphere.

May typically offers mild temperatures ranging from 10 to 15 degrees Celsius, making it an ideal time for exploring the scenic surrounding countryside. You can enjoy the delightful sight of wildflowers in full bloom and take part in local events that showcase the rich heritage of Audlem. The community often hosts festivals, providing an authentic taste of village life.

For those looking for a more budget-friendly option, November presents a quieter time to visit. While the weather may be cooler, you can experience the beauty of the countryside in a more tranquil setting, superb for cosy pursuits like enjoying a warm drink in a local café or visiting the historic church without the crowds.
